Ford Equity International Rating and Forecast Report

Ford Equity International Research Reports cover 60 countries with over 30,000 stocks traded on international exchanges. A proprietary quantitative system compares each company to its peers on proven measures of business value, growth characteristics, and investor behavior. Ford's three recommendation ratings buy, hold and sell, represent each stock’s return potential relative to its own country market.. The rating reports which are generated each week, include the fundamental details behind each recommendation and reflect the fundamental and price data as of the last trading day of the week.

Mitsubishi Nichiyu Forklift

Mitsubishi Nichiyu Forklift is engaged in the manufacture, sale and maintenance of electric forklifts and material handling equipment. Along with its subsidiaries and associated companies, Co. operates in two business segments: domestic and overseas. Co.'s principal products include small and medium-size electric forklift trucks, IC (internal combustion) forklift trucks, lift trucks, automated guided vehicles, stackers, pallet trucks, reach trucks, order pickers, towing tractors and other material handling equipment. Co. provides "Mitsubishi," "Nichiyu," "CAT" and "Rocla" brands equipment. Co. operates its operations in Japan, the U.S., the Netherlands, China, Thailand and Singapore.
